Cover image: Antibodies for the human orthologue of MATE1 (hMATE1) predominantly immunostained the apical regions of the proximal and distal convoluted tubules of the kidney. MATE1 is the first mammalian orthologue of the multidrug and toxin extrusion (MATE) family, conferring multidrug resistance to bacteria. hMATE1 mediates the final excretion step for toxic organic cations in the kidney and liver through an H+-coupled antiport mechanism.
